About Cartagena

In the city of Cartagena in Colombia, according to 2005 data, there is a population of about 895,000 people. Founded in 1533 by Pedro de Heredia, the city is a protected colonial harbor with low elevation, and in 1815 it gained its independence and received the title of "hero city". The city, which is one of the tourism centers of the country with Santa Marta, is built around a large lagoon and has large beaches. Located in the UNESCO World Heritage List, it is also known as Colombia's fifth largest city. In the city, maritime and petrochemical industries are emphasized, and the tourism sector is also very front-line. In a city with a rainy and dry tropical climate, the temperature varies from 26 to 30C throughout the year. Rainfall is seen between May and December.
